牛津词典

    noun

    • 堕落;颓废;贪图享乐
      behaviour, attitudes, etc. which show a fall in standards, especially moral ones, and an interest in pleasure and enjoyment rather than more serious things
      1. the decadence of modern Western society
        现代西方社会的颓废现象
